Energy Poverty Reduction (Use of Surplus Renewable Energy) Bill 2025 (Bill 6 of 2025)

368 0
Bill entitled\xa0an\xa0Act to require the Minister for the Environment, Climate and Communications to develop and publish a strategy to ensure that surplus renewable energy is utilised effectively, specifically for the benefit of people experiencing energy poverty, and to set targets for the utilisation of surplus renewable energy.
